As cheerful - no, joyful - as they come, even with a bout of gleeful laughter at the end of the first refrain!
Jerry just loved Eyes, according to his primary biographer (Blair Jackson), and, even in the last desperate year of the band, it was one of the songs that remained fresh and inventive as ever.

Phil!
Second set is a must for any Phil freak. He's out front in the mix and bouncing all over the place. As a result the China->Rider, Eyes sequence is just freakin' sublime. Plus, Jerry's havin' a damn fine night as well.
Phil on + Jerry on = monster show.
Sound quality wavers from three and a half stars at the beginning of set one to a full four stars by mid set two. Thanks to Charlie Miller for all he does.
